* test(infra): retry recursive temp-dir removal instead of failing a shard on ENOTEMPTY (#11966)

Two shards on release/v3.8.51 went red in one day with the same signature —
"ENOTEMPTY, Directory not empty: /tmp/omniroute-<test>-XXXXXX" — from
combo-same-provider-cascade (Unit Tests fast-path 4/4, on a PR that touches only
.github/) and auth-policy-embeddings-webfetch-7785 (the 20k-test TIA step). Both pass
alone and on re-run: the cleanup races something still writing into the directory
(SQLite WAL/-shm checkpoint, a worker, the backup) and under a loaded hosted runner
the window opens. 1154 test files do their own cleanup with
fs.rmSync(dir, { recursive: true, force: true }); 57 already asked for retries.

One-shot codemod (scripts/ad-hoc/codemod-rm-maxretries.mjs, kept for the record):
every rm / rmSync / rmdirSync option object with `recursive: true` and no
`maxRetries` gains `maxRetries: 5, retryDelay: 100` — Node itself then retries
ENOTEMPTY/EBUSY/EPERM for up to ~0.5 s before giving up. 2243 call sites in 1292
files under tests/, the shared tests/_setup/isolateDataDir.ts exit hook included.
Only the option object changes: no call site, assertion or import is touched.

Validation: prettier and ESLint (with the frozen suppressions) clean on all 1292
files; a random 20-file sample runs green (quota-redis-store hangs identically on
the untouched tree — it needs a Redis on localhost, an environment matter). The
four unit shards on this PR are the full run.

* fix(quality): let check-forgotten-sibling-tests read a 1,000-file diff

The gate shells out to `git diff` through execFileSync with Node's default 1 MB
maxBuffer; the 1,292-file codemod in this PR is the first diff large enough to
overflow it, and the gate died with `spawnSync git ENOBUFS` before comparing
anything. 64 MB is far above any real PR and costs nothing when unused.

import test from "node:test";
import assert from "node:assert/strict";
import fs from "node:fs";
import os from "node:os";
import path from "node:path";
const TEST_DATA_DIR = fs.mkdtempSync(path.join(os.tmpdir(), "omniroute-opencode-models-"));
process.env.DATA_DIR = TEST_DATA_DIR;
const core = await import("../../src/lib/db/core.ts");
const providersDb = await import("../../src/lib/db/providers.ts");
const modelsRoute = await import("../../src/app/api/providers/[id]/models/route.ts");
test.after(() => {
core.resetDbInstance();
fs.rmSync(TEST_DATA_DIR, { recursive: true, force: true, maxRetries: 5, retryDelay: 100 });
});
// #3047 — OpenCode Free (no-auth) has no connection row, so the
// "Import from /models" button used to hit a 404 and silently no-op. The models
// route must serve a non-empty model list when called with a no-auth provider id.
// #3611 — the source may now be "upstream" (live fetch succeeded) or
// "local_catalog" (live fetch failed/unavailable); both are acceptable here.
test("models route serves models for a no-auth provider id (#3047)", async () => {
const response = await modelsRoute.GET(
new Request("http://localhost/api/providers/opencode/models?refresh=true"),
{ params: { id: "opencode" } }
);
assert.equal(response.status, 200);
const body = await response.json();
assert.equal(body.provider, "opencode");
assert.ok(
body.source === "local_catalog" || body.source === "upstream",
`source must be 'local_catalog' or 'upstream', got '${body.source}'`
);
assert.ok(Array.isArray(body.models) && body.models.length > 0, "should return catalog models");
assert.ok(
body.models.every((m: { id?: unknown }) => typeof m.id === "string" && m.id.length > 0),
"every model must have a non-empty id"
);
});
test("models route still 404s for an unknown provider/connection id", async () => {
const response = await modelsRoute.GET(
new Request("http://localhost/api/providers/does-not-exist-xyz/models"),
{ params: { id: "does-not-exist-xyz" } }
);
assert.equal(response.status, 404);
});
// #3611 — OpenCode Free (noAuth + modelsUrl) must fetch live models from the
// provider's modelsUrl instead of always returning the stale local_catalog.
const LIVE_MODEL_LIST = [
{ id: "live-model-alpha", object: "model" },
{ id: "live-model-beta", object: "model" },
];
test("models route fetches live models from modelsUrl for noAuth provider with modelsUrl (#3611)", async () => {
const originalFetch = globalThis.fetch;
globalThis.fetch = async (url: string | URL, _init?: RequestInit) => {
const urlStr = String(url);
if (urlStr === "https://opencode.ai/zen/v1/models") {
return Response.json({ data: LIVE_MODEL_LIST });
}
return new Response("unexpected fetch: " + urlStr, { status: 500 });
};
try {
const response = await modelsRoute.GET(
new Request("http://localhost/api/providers/opencode/models"),
{ params: { id: "opencode" } }
);
assert.equal(response.status, 200);
const body = await response.json();
assert.equal(body.provider, "opencode");
assert.equal(
body.source,
"upstream",
"should report source as 'upstream' when live fetch succeeds"
);
assert.ok(Array.isArray(body.models), "models should be an array");
const ids = body.models.map((m: { id: string }) => m.id);
assert.ok(ids.includes("live-model-alpha"), "should include live model alpha");
assert.ok(ids.includes("live-model-beta"), "should include live model beta");
} finally {
globalThis.fetch = originalFetch;
}
});
test("metadata-only no-auth connection row still uses public model discovery", async () => {
const connection = await providersDb.createProviderConnection({
provider: "opencode",
authType: "apikey",
name: "opencode-metadata",
isActive: true,
testStatus: "unknown",
providerSpecificData: {
fingerprints: [{ id: "fingerprint-1" }],
accountProxies: [],
},
});
const originalFetch = globalThis.fetch;
globalThis.fetch = async (url: string | URL) => {
if (String(url) === "https://opencode.ai/zen/v1/models") {
return Response.json({ data: LIVE_MODEL_LIST });
}
return new Response("unexpected", { status: 500 });
};
try {
const response = await modelsRoute.GET(
new Request(`http://localhost/api/providers/${connection.id}/models`),
{ params: { id: connection.id } }
);
assert.equal(response.status, 200);
const body = await response.json();
assert.equal(body.provider, "opencode");
assert.equal(body.connectionId, connection.id);
assert.equal(body.source, "upstream");
assert.ok(body.models.some((model: { id: string }) => model.id === "live-model-alpha"));
} finally {
globalThis.fetch = originalFetch;
}
});
test("models route falls back to local_catalog when live modelsUrl fetch throws (#3611 fallback on error)", async () => {
const originalFetch = globalThis.fetch;
globalThis.fetch = async (url: string | URL, _init?: RequestInit) => {
if (String(url) === "https://opencode.ai/zen/v1/models") {
throw new Error("network failure");
}
return new Response("unexpected", { status: 500 });
};
try {
const response = await modelsRoute.GET(
new Request("http://localhost/api/providers/opencode/models"),
{ params: { id: "opencode" } }
);
assert.equal(response.status, 200);
const body = await response.json();
assert.equal(body.provider, "opencode");
assert.equal(body.source, "local_catalog", "should fall back to local_catalog on fetch error");
assert.ok(Array.isArray(body.models) && body.models.length > 0, "should have catalog models");
} finally {
globalThis.fetch = originalFetch;
}
});
test("models route falls back to local_catalog when live modelsUrl fetch returns non-OK (#3611 fallback on non-OK)", async () => {
const originalFetch = globalThis.fetch;
globalThis.fetch = async (url: string | URL, _init?: RequestInit) => {
if (String(url) === "https://opencode.ai/zen/v1/models") {
return new Response("Service Unavailable", { status: 503 });
}
return new Response("unexpected", { status: 500 });
};
try {
const response = await modelsRoute.GET(
new Request("http://localhost/api/providers/opencode/models"),
{ params: { id: "opencode" } }
);
assert.equal(response.status, 200);
const body = await response.json();
assert.equal(body.provider, "opencode");
assert.equal(
body.source,
"local_catalog",
"should fall back to local_catalog when upstream returns non-OK"
);
assert.ok(Array.isArray(body.models) && body.models.length > 0, "should have catalog models");
} finally {
globalThis.fetch = originalFetch;
}
});
